MagnetGold (MTG) traded 4.7% lower against the U.S. dollar during the 1 day period ending at 10:00 AM ET on September 30th. In the last seven days, MagnetGold has traded 13.3% lower against the U.S. dollar. One MagnetGold token can now be purchased for approximately $0.0212 or 0.00000019 BTC on major cryptocurrency exchanges. MagnetGold has a market cap of $5.78 million and approximately $485.56 worth of MagnetGold was traded on exchanges in the last 24 hours.

About MagnetGold
MagnetGold launched on August 25th, 2021. MagnetGold’s total supply is 700,000,000 tokens and its circulating supply is 272,606,905 tokens. MagnetGold’s official Twitter account is @ymagnetgold and its Facebook page is accessible here. MagnetGold’s official website is mtggold.com/indexmain.html.
